Please choose the one you would prefer to see more of.

Bare in mind this is a balancing act.

If you like 10 Day events Option 1 is not feasible and 2 or 3 must be considered.

If you like 1 day events Option 1 is more feasible but not mandatory.

Physical (Tangible) events are always going to cost more to run so this will be factor is regularity, feasibility and the size of prizes and significantly affect the entry fee.

Agree with this in theory.

I think a major consideration in the photo entry change over was inclusion.

We did not want copious dead fish brought in for a dead weigh in (some by people that dont eat fish) especially as community that has desire to promote sustainabilty.

But we wanted people who dont have the required equipment to keep fish alive for prolonged periods to still be able to enter.

Take Threadfin Salmon.

Realistically its a photo or a dead fish. Same with Jew, Sharks etc.
